Local SEO

Mastering Local SEO: A Comprehensive Guide to Analyzing Competition

Getting your Trinity Audio player ready...

Local SEO, or local search engine optimization, is the process of optimizing a website to rank higher in local search results. It involves targeting specific geographic locations and tailoring the website’s content and structure to appeal to local customers. Local SEO is crucial for businesses that rely on local customers, such as brick-and-mortar stores, restaurants, and service providers.

The importance of local SEO cannot be overstated. In today’s digital age, consumers are increasingly turning to search engines to find local businesses. According to a study by Google, 46% of all searches have local intent. This means that nearly half of all searches are conducted with the intention of finding a local business or service.

Implementing effective local SEO strategies can bring numerous benefits to businesses. Firstly, it can increase visibility in local search results, making it easier for potential customers to find and contact the business. This can lead to increased website traffic, foot traffic, and ultimately, sales.

Secondly, local SEO can help businesses build trust and credibility with their target audience. When a business appears in the top search results for a specific location, it signals to consumers that the business is reputable and trustworthy.

Lastly, local SEO can provide a competitive advantage. By optimizing their website for local searches, businesses can outrank their competitors and attract more customers in their target area.

Key Takeaways

  • Local SEO is important for businesses to reach their target audience in their local area.
  • Understanding the local search landscape and ranking factors is crucial for optimizing your website for local searches.
  • Analyzing your local competition can help you identify key players and their strategies to improve your own local SEO.
  • Conducting keyword research and optimizing your website for local searches can increase your visibility in local search results.
  • Creating and managing your Google My Business listing is essential for local SEO success.

Understanding the Local Search Landscape and Ranking Factors

To effectively implement local SEO strategies, it is important to understand the local search landscape and the factors that affect local search rankings.

The local search landscape refers to the ecosystem of online platforms and directories where businesses can list their information. These platforms include search engines like Google and Bing, as well as online directories like Yelp and Yellow Pages.

When it comes to ranking factors for local searches, there are several key factors that influence how a website ranks in local search results. These factors include the relevance of the website’s content to the search query, the proximity of the business to the searcher’s location, and the prominence of the business in the local community.

One important ranking factor that businesses should pay attention to is NAP consistency. NAP stands for Name, Address, and Phone Number. It is crucial for businesses to ensure that their NAP information is consistent across all online platforms and directories. Inconsistent NAP information can confuse search engines and negatively impact a website’s local search rankings.

Analyzing Your Local Competition: Identifying Key Players and Their Strategies

Analyzing local competition is an essential step in developing effective local SEO strategies. By understanding who your competitors are and how they are positioning themselves in the local market, you can identify opportunities to differentiate your business and gain a competitive edge.

To identify your key competitors, start by conducting a search for your target keywords on search engines like Google. Take note of the businesses that appear in the top search results for these keywords. These businesses are likely your main competitors in the local market.

Once you have identified your competitors, analyze their websites and online presence to understand their strategies. Look at their website content, keywords, and meta tags to see how they are targeting local customers. Pay attention to their online reviews and social media presence as well, as these can provide insights into how they are engaging with their audience.

By analyzing your competitors’ strategies, you can gain valuable insights into what is working in the local market and identify areas where you can improve or differentiate your own business.

Conducting Keyword Research and Optimizing Your Website for Local Searches

Metrics Description
Keyword research The process of identifying popular search terms related to your business or industry.
Local search volume The number of searches for a specific keyword in a particular geographic location.
Competition level The number of other websites competing for the same keyword in the same location.
Keyword difficulty A metric that measures how difficult it is to rank for a specific keyword based on competition and search volume.
On-page optimization The process of optimizing website content, meta tags, and other elements to improve search engine rankings.
Local business listings Online directories that list local businesses and provide information such as address, phone number, and website.
Google My Business A free tool provided by Google that allows businesses to manage their online presence across Google, including search and maps.
Local citations Online mentions of a business’s name, address, and phone number (NAP) on other websites.
Reviews and ratings The number and quality of reviews and ratings a business has on various platforms, such as Google, Yelp, and Facebook.

Keyword research is a critical component of local SEO. By identifying the keywords that potential customers are using to find businesses like yours, you can optimize your website to rank higher in local search results.

To conduct keyword research for local searches, start by brainstorming a list of relevant keywords that are specific to your business and location. For example, if you are a bakery in New York City, some relevant keywords might include “New York City bakery,” “best bakery in NYC,” and “cupcakes in Manhattan.”

Once you have a list of potential keywords, use keyword research tools like Google Keyword Planner or SEMrush to determine the search volume and competition level for each keyword. Focus on keywords with high search volume and low competition, as these are the keywords that are most likely to drive traffic to your website.

Once you have identified your target keywords, optimize your website by incorporating these keywords into your website’s content, meta tags, and URLs. However, it is important to use keywords naturally and avoid keyword stuffing, as this can negatively impact your website’s rankings.

Creating and Managing Your Google My Business Listing

Google My Business is a free tool provided by Google that allows businesses to manage their online presence on Google. It is an essential tool for local SEO, as it helps businesses appear in Google’s local search results and on Google Maps.

Creating a Google My Business listing is simple. Start by visiting the Google My Business website and clicking on the “Start Now” button. Follow the prompts to enter your business information, including your business name, address, phone number, and website URL.

Once you have created your listing, it is important to optimize it for local searches. This includes selecting the most relevant categories for your business, uploading high-quality photos of your business and products, and encouraging customers to leave reviews.

Managing your Google My Business listing is equally important. Regularly update your listing with any changes to your business information, such as new phone numbers or addresses. Respond to customer reviews promptly and professionally, whether they are positive or negative. This shows potential customers that you value their feedback and are committed to providing excellent customer service.

Building Local Citations and Managing Online Reviews

Local citations are mentions of your business’s NAP information on other websites and directories. They are an important factor in local search rankings, as they help search engines verify the accuracy and legitimacy of your business information.

To build local citations, start by listing your business on popular online directories like Yelp, Yellow Pages, and TripAdvisor. Be sure to include your NAP information and a link to your website in each listing.

It is also important to manage your online reviews. Positive reviews can boost your business’s reputation and attract more customers, while negative reviews can have the opposite effect. Encourage satisfied customers to leave reviews on platforms like Google My Business, Yelp, and Facebook. Respond to negative reviews promptly and professionally, addressing any concerns or issues raised by the customer.

Leveraging Social Media for Local SEO

Social media can play a significant role in local SEO. By leveraging social media platforms like Facebook, Instagram, and Twitter, businesses can increase their visibility in local search results and engage with their target audience.

When choosing the right social media platforms for your business, consider where your target audience is most active. For example, if you are targeting a younger demographic, platforms like Instagram and Snapchat may be more effective. If you are targeting professionals or B2B customers, platforms like LinkedIn may be more suitable.

Optimize your social media profiles for local searches by including your NAP information and relevant keywords in your profile descriptions. Regularly post content that is relevant to your target audience and engage with your followers by responding to comments and messages.

Implementing Local Link Building Strategies

Local link building involves acquiring backlinks from other websites that are relevant to your business and located in the same geographic area. Backlinks are an important ranking factor for search engines, as they signal to search engines that your website is reputable and trustworthy.

To identify local link building opportunities, start by reaching out to other local businesses and organizations that are related to your industry. Offer to write guest blog posts or contribute to their websites in exchange for a backlink. You can also sponsor local events or charities and ask for a backlink in return.

It is important to note that quality is more important than quantity when it comes to link building. Focus on acquiring backlinks from reputable websites with high domain authority, as these will have a greater impact on your website’s rankings.

Tracking and Measuring Your Local SEO Success

Tracking and measuring the success of your local SEO efforts is crucial for identifying what is working and what needs improvement. By monitoring key metrics, you can make data-driven decisions and optimize your strategies for better results.

Some key metrics to track include website traffic, keyword rankings, and online conversions. Use tools like Google Analytics and Google Search Console to track these metrics and gain insights into how your website is performing in local search results.

In addition to these tools, there are also specialized local SEO tools available that can provide more detailed insights into your local search rankings and performance. These tools can help you identify areas for improvement and track the success of your local SEO strategies over time.

Staying Ahead of the Game: Best Practices for Continuous Local SEO Improvement

Local SEO is an ongoing process that requires continuous improvement and adaptation. To stay ahead of the game, it is important to stay up-to-date with the latest local SEO trends and updates.

One best practice for continuous local SEO improvement is to regularly audit your website and online presence. This involves reviewing your website’s content, meta tags, and NAP information to ensure they are up-to-date and optimized for local searches. It also involves monitoring your online reviews and social media presence to address any issues or concerns raised by customers.

Another best practice is to stay informed about local SEO trends and updates. Subscribe to industry blogs, attend webinars, and participate in forums to stay up-to-date with the latest developments in local SEO. This will help you adapt your strategies and stay ahead of your competitors.
In conclusion, local SEO is crucial for businesses that rely on local customers. It can increase visibility, build trust and credibility, and provide a competitive advantage. By understanding the local search landscape, analyzing local competition, conducting keyword research, optimizing their website, creating and managing their Google My Business listing, building local citations, leveraging social media, implementing local link building strategies, tracking and measuring their success, and continuously improving their strategies, businesses can effectively implement local SEO and attract more customers in their target area. It is essential for businesses to prioritize local SEO and take advantage of the numerous benefits it can bring.

If you’re looking to gain a competitive edge in the world of local SEO, then you need to check out this detailed guide on analyzing local SEO competition. This comprehensive article provides valuable insights and strategies to help you understand and outperform your competitors in the local search results. But that’s not all! While you’re at it, make sure to also explore this informative article on unlocking the potential of drop servicing. It offers a step-by-step guide to building a profitable online business. And if you’re specifically interested in boosting your online presence, don’t miss out on this article highlighting the best search engine optimization agency in India. With their expertise, you can take your website’s visibility to new heights.


What is local SEO competition?

Local SEO competition refers to the businesses or websites that are competing for the same target audience in a specific geographic location. It involves analyzing the strengths and weaknesses of your competitors to improve your own local SEO strategy.

Why is it important to analyze local SEO competition?

Analyzing local SEO competition helps you understand the market and identify opportunities to improve your own local SEO strategy. It also helps you stay ahead of your competitors and attract more customers to your business.

What are the key factors to consider when analyzing local SEO competition?

The key factors to consider when analyzing local SEO competition include the competitor’s website structure, content, keywords, backlinks, social media presence, and online reviews. These factors help you understand the strengths and weaknesses of your competitors and identify areas for improvement in your own local SEO strategy.

What are some tools to use for analyzing local SEO competition?

There are several tools available for analyzing local SEO competition, including Google My Business, Google Maps, SEMrush, Ahrefs, Moz, and BrightLocal. These tools help you track your competitors’ rankings, keywords, backlinks, and online reviews.

How can I improve my local SEO strategy based on my analysis of local SEO competition?

Based on your analysis of local SEO competition, you can improve your local SEO strategy by optimizing your website structure, content, keywords, backlinks, social media presence, and online reviews. You can also identify new opportunities to target your audience and improve your local search rankings.

Scroll to Top